What is Windshield Pitting?

Windshield pitting is wear and tear the car windshield experiences over time. In some cases, it might get heavy damage from forceful external impacts. Also, there are cases when the windshield develops scratch marks. Pitting degrades the windshield quality to a significant extent.

Causes of Windshield Pitting

1. Windblown Sand

You need to keep in mind that windblown sand can cause the pitting of your car’s windshield. There are more chances of the phenomenon in dry, arid areas or dusty terrains. The tiny sand particles have the capacity to damage the surface of the windshield.

2. Sharp objects propelled by strong winds

When strong winds propel a sharp object and hit the windshield, it can damage the glass. For example, when you drive in stormy weather, there is a good probability of windshield damage in such a manner. You must remain alert and drive carefully.

3. Debris from Vehicle Tyes in the Vicinity

It is a factor that many car owners overlook. The glass surface of the windshield can get damaged from the debris that tires of nearby vehicles throw. The debris particles can impact the glass and crack it. It leads to recognizable windshield pitting.

4. UV rays can cause pitting

Do you know that UV rays can have negative effects on windshields? When you park your car for long hours under direct sun, it can cause pitting. Also, when you drive for long hours in scorching heat, there are good chances for the vehicle to experience wear and tear.

5. Heavy Rains

In some cases, heavy rain is a significant cause of windshield pitting. Generally, trademarked OEM windshields are strong enough to resist heavy showers. But, in some cases, when there are strong rains, the windshield of your car can get scratched. Driving in heavy rains can highly cause damage.

6. Pollution

Pollution is yet another factor that can lead to windshield pitting. It happens in the long run, not overnight. You may be a resident of a highly polluted city. Driving a car for many months in such a location gradually corrodes the glass surface, affecting its appearance.

7. Salty air may lead to pitting

Do you know that even salty air can cause pitting to your car’s windshield? For example, if you live in a coastal region and drive a car regularly, you can observe the pitting marks after a few months.

Why you Should be Concerned about Windshield Pitting?

Windshield pitting is undoubtedly a matter of concern. You must seriously address the wear and tear of your car’s windshield. There are many risks involved in driving a car that has experienced pitting on the car glass. Some of the risks are:

  • Driving in bright, sunny days can be blinding sometimes
  • It may become very difficult to drive and guess the way when visibility gets affected by headlights of a vehicle coming towards you
  • There is a sharp drop in the structural integrity of your car windshield
  • Pits can become worse and lead to severe cracks in many cases
